For the “Melania” documentary, there is no single, authoritative total ticket count available yet, but we do have some concrete snapshots from reporting and cinema data.
What we actually know
- In Palm Beach (near Mar‑a‑Lago), one Regal cinema sold 234 seats out of 1,770 available for opening weekend, about 13% of capacity.
- For that same site, 181 of 590 seats were sold for opening day Friday alone, roughly 31% of that day’s capacity.
- In the UK, early showings were described as “soft,” with one major report noting just one ticket sold for the first screening at a flagship London cinema and only a handful (single‑digit sales) at several other sites.
- A major theater chain executive in the UK also described overall early demand as “soft” across their locations.
- Industry coverage ahead of release projected around 3 million dollars in opening‑weekend box office in North America, with about 1,500 theaters scheduled to show the film. These are projections, not final ticket counts.
Because ticket sales are scattered across many chains and countries and only partial figures have been reported, no reliable global “how many tickets did Melania sell” number exists yet. The best we can say from current public info is that early sales look weak to very weak in multiple markets , despite a large reported acquisition and marketing spend.
